About Iodoform



Iodoform is a pungent, yellow crystalline powder with a characteristic sweet taste but is toxic if ingested or inhaled. With a purity of typically >99%, it is widely used as an antiseptic chemical intermediate and in certain veterinary applications. This halogenated organic compound boasts antiseptic, volatile, and slightly soluble properties, making it suitable for wound treatment and chemical synthesis. Stored in cool, dry places in tightly sealed containers to protect from moisture and light, Iodoform is available in technical/industrial/pharmaceutical grades. Highly soluble in ethanol, ether, and other organic solvents, this substance is neutral to slightly acidic and has a melting point of 119C.
